The Calm Before the Storm

In the dramatic world of Baddies Midwest, tension brews faster than a tropical storm in Hawaii. Episode 20 of the hit Zeus Network reality series delivered exactly what fans live for: high drama, fierce personalities, and unpredictable chaos. This time, the spotlight landed squarely on Summer, who engaged in a fiery altercation with fellow baddies Jazmin and Yoshi during their exotic trip to Hawaii. What started as a minor disagreement erupted into one of the most talked-about showdowns of the season.
Paradise Turns into a Pressure Cooker
- The baddies had just landed in Hawaii for what was supposed to be a celebratory getaway.
- Tensions were already running high due to unresolved issues from earlier episodes.
- Natalie Nunn attempted to keep the peace, but the mounting friction was too volatile to contain.
As the group enjoyed drinks by the beach, a spark ignited between Summer and Jazmin over a perceived slight involving side comments and alliances. Yoshi, defending Jazmin, stepped in—and that’s when things truly exploded.
Summer vs. Jazmin and Yoshi
- Summer called out Jazmin for allegedly “talking behind her back.”
- Jazmin clapped back, denying the accusations and mocking Summer’s attitude.
- Yoshi tried to play peacemaker at first but quickly took sides when Summer got personal.
- Within seconds, voices were raised, drinks were thrown, and security was called in to break it up.
This wasn’t just a shouting match—it was a three-way firestorm. The scene went viral on social media within hours, with fans picking sides and analyzing every frame.
After the Smoke Cleared
- Natalie Nunn expressed disappointment in how the altercation overshadowed the Hawaii trip.
- Jazmin and Yoshi formed a tighter alliance, distancing themselves from Summer.
- Summer, unshaken, vowed to stand her ground and promised fans that the reunion episode would be even more explosive.
